Don Doko Don is a classic fixed-screen arcade platformer developed by Taito and released in 1989. Following in the footsteps of the beloved Bubble Bobble, you play as bearded lumberjacks Bob and Jim on a quest to rescue the king and princess of Marry Land. Instead of blowing bubbles, you wield giant mallets to stun the various enemies that populate each single-screen stage. Once an enemy is dazed, you can pick them up and hurl them across the level to take out other foes, turning them into bonus fruit and high-score items.
How to Play
The objective is to clear every enemy from the screen to advance to the next stage. Use the directional keys to move and climb ladders. Press your primary action button to swing your mallet and stun enemies, then walk into a stunned enemy to pick them up. Press attack again to throw them. If you take too long on a single stage, an invincible enemy will appear and chase you down, so keep moving!
Tips
- Throw enemies into groups: A thrown enemy will barrel through others, taking out multiple targets at once and rewarding you with better point items.
- Watch for hidden items: Striking empty air in certain spots or defeating enemies in specific ways can reveal secret power-ups that increase your speed or attack range.
